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Station Facilities and Services

Tickets at Lye station are managed predominantly through the use of ticket machines, as there is no traditional ticket office on site. It’s best to purchase tickets online and collect them conveniently at a ticket machine. However, note that the ticket machines are not accessible. Help points and staff assistance are available should you need guidance during weekdays from early morning until late evening, and on a more limited schedule over weekends. While the station is accredited by the Secure Station Scheme, certain amenities such as public toilets or refreshment facilities are not available at Lye station. Those planning to cycle can find stands for securing their bikes, although there is no sheltered storage.

Accessibility Options

For passengers requiring additional accessibility features, Lye station is partially equipped with step-free access to platforms, categorized under the B1 classification, which may involve longer or steeper ramps. However, passengers should be aware that a comprehensive network of accessible ticket machines and toilets is lacking. Assistance for boarding trains can be sought from the attentive conductors on site, ensuring smooth travel for travelers with mobility needs.

Facilities and Amenities

While Bond Street Station on the Elizabeth line does not have a traditional ticket office, purchasing tickets is still a breeze with the presence of accessible ticket machines throughout the station. It's worth noting that tickets bought online cannot be collected here, but the handy machines ensure you have everything you need. For passengers requiring assistance, various help points are available alongside screens displaying arrival and departure information.

The station adopts a superior accessibility ethos, offering step-free access throughout and boarding ramps for the Jubilee line services. There’s a consistent provision of induction loops at the ticket machines, enhancing the accessibility experience for passengers with hearing difficulties. On the flip side, the station lacks some commonly found conveniences such as waiting rooms, luggage storage, and catering facilities. It's advisable to plan ahead for these needs before visiting Bond Street Station.
